This one had me stumped for a while. I had some flowers on my desk that I had cut and colored for another card but didn’t end up using. I knew I wanted to use them for a Mother’s Day card, so I decided to make them work for this sketch. I may have taken some creative liberties with the sketch, but hopefully you can see it in my card.
I used a couple of retiring products on this card — the Irresistibly Floral Specialty DSP and my favorite retiring In Color, Watermelon Wonder. The images were stamped on Shimmery White card stock and colored with a blender pen and ink pads. The sentiment is from the Thoughtful Banners stamp set.
